AceShowbiz - New details have emerged regarding the production schedule for the next chapter in the Extraction franchise. The highly anticipated sequel, Extraction 3, starring Chris Hemsworth as Tyler Rake, is slated to begin principal photography in June 2026.
According to a report from What's on Netflix, filming is expected to continue through October 9, 2026. The production will primarily take place in Sydney, Australia, which is the home country of Chris Hemsworth. Additionally, some scenes are planned to be shot in Europe during the summer months, although exact locations have yet to be confirmed.
Extraction 3 will see the return of director Sam Hargrave, who directed the first two films in the series. The project is produced by AGBO, the company founded by Anthony and Joe Russo. Joe Russo is also expected to write the screenplay. Other producers involved include Mike Larocca, Angela Russo-Otstot, Eric Gitter, and Peter Schwerin, with Fraser Taggart serving as the cinematographer.
The franchise is based on the graphic novel Ciudad, created by Ande Parks along with Joe and Anthony Russo. It follows the story of Tyler Rake, a black ops mercenary tasked with high-stakes international rescue operations. Joe Russo has mentioned the team is exploring ways to expand the storytelling beyond Tyler Rake’s journey.
Beyond Extraction 3, Netflix is also developing additional projects within the franchise. An eight-episode spin-off series called Mercenary, starring Omar Sy, focuses on a mercenary involved in a hostage rescue mission in Libya. Another spin-off film titled Tygo features Don Lee as a former child soldier turned mercenary navigating South Korea’s criminal underworld.
The announcement of Extraction 3 came during Netflix Tudum in 2023, confirming the continuation of the R-rated action series. Fans can look forward to a return of the intense, adrenaline-fueled narrative when production begins in mid-2026.
